Ingredients

  • 4 chicken breasts, boneless, skinless, halved, and flattened to even thickness
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on coarse ground black pepper
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 cups dry breadcrumbs
  • 1 teaspoon dried basil leaves, optional
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ano, optional
  • vegetable oil, to taste, for frying

Directions

Step 1 –Season the chicken with salt and pepper.

Step 2 –In a shallow bowl, whisk the eggs.

Step 3 –In a second shallow bowl, add the breadcrumbs, basil, and oregano.

Step 4 –Dip each of the seasoned pieces of chicken into the egg mixture and then the breadcrumb mixture. Gently press the breadcrumbs into the mixture while dipping.

Step 5 –Carefully place the coated chicken on a baking sheet.

Step 6 –Let the chicken rest for 10 minutes.

Step 7 –In a large pot over medium heat, heat 2 inches of oil.

Step 8 –Add the rested chicken to the pot. Be sure not to overcrowd, while also placing the chicken away from you to avoid splashing.

Step 9 –Cook the chicken on each side until an instant thermometer inserted into the center reads 165 degrees F, about 6-8 minutes.
